Konstantin Artiouchine Philippe Baptiste Christoph Dürr

We study a scheduling problem, motivated by air-traffic control, in which a set of aircrafts are about to land on a single runway. When coming close to the landing area of the airport, a set of time windows in which the landing is possible, is automatically assigned to each aircraft. Antonio A. Trani Hanif D. Sherali Byung J. Kim

An interactive microcomputer program referred to as runway exit design interactive model (REDIM) has been developed to optimally locate and design high-speed runway exits at airports. The model uses kinematic equations to characterize the aircraft landing dynamics and a polynomial-time dynamic programming algorithm to find the optimal locations of the high-speed exits.
